October 18, 201411 yr I am using 3 1920x1080 monitors. All you have to do is check "black out" and specify the larger resolution ... for each monitor ... using the dropdown box for the GPU selection where resolution is set for full screen in P3D. It works beautifully. This works fine if you are spanning monitors or dragging gauges across to the second monitor. However, if you wish to view other apps on the second monitor, e.g. EFB, AS Next, then it does not work as you are basically assigning the second monitor to P3D/FSX.

October 18, 201411 yr Commercial Member I suspect it's going to be possible to produce even better image quality on the high end cards like the 970 and 980 by applying a small amount of normal AA in conjunction with the DSR - even 2x or something will probably be enough to almost completely eliminate all shimmering, even at really oblique angles to the object. DSR is effectively like brute force supersample AA already with some enhancements, so I'm thinking that we can essentially use it to create a really high quality version of the combined "#xS" modes from the pre-DSR era by tacking some light MSAA on. (also interested to try the 9 series's new MFAA algorithm out too) Since I have been doing my flights with DSR (1.5x, 2x and even 4x) I can't seem to completely finish a flight without a OOM. Anyone else see a huge difference in VAS when doing this? This might make sense actually - DX9 shadows in-use VRAM into VAS unfortunately and running 4K vs. 1080p will definitely increase VRAM usage somewhat. You can monitor/log it with FSUIPC and test. GPU-Z or any of the utilities like MSI Afterburner or EVGA precision should be able to show you the card's true VRAM use too.
